While merchants may have amended their pricing to accomodate credit card fee's, absent credit cards, they would or did have to amend them for bad checks and cash management. I believe banks charge merchants for bulk coinage for change, no?

 

I remember a client of mine who was in the building supply (ceramic tiles/bath/kitchen fixtures) business who stopped contractors accounts. If the contractor couldn't or wouldn't pay prior to delivery the owner of the home where the material was being installed had to come to his store to pay for the material. He said it was one of the best decisions he ever made. The credit card vig paled in comparison to the cost of extending credit to his contractor base.
